#include "includes.h"
#include "libnet/libnet.h"
#if defined(HAVE_ADS) && defined(ENCTYPE_ARCFOUR_HMAC)
/****************************************************************
****************************************************************/
static NTSTATUS parse_object(TALLOC_CTX *mem_ctx,
struct libnet_keytab_context *ctx,
struct drsuapi_DsReplicaObjectListItemEx *cur)
{
NTSTATUS status = NT_STATUS_OK;
uchar nt_passwd[16];
struct libnet_keytab_entry entry;
DATA_BLOB *blob;
int i = 0;
struct drsuapi_DsReplicaAttribute *attr;
bool got_pwd = false;
char *upn = NULL;
char *name = NULL;
uint32_t kvno = 0;
uint32_t uacc = 0;
uint32_t sam_type = 0;
uint32_t pwd_history_len = 0;
uint8_t *pwd_history = NULL;
ZERO_STRUCT(nt_passwd);
for (i=0; i < cur->object.attribute_ctr.num_attributes; i++) {
attr = &cur->object.attribute_ctr.attributes[i];
if (attr->value_ctr.num_values != 1) {
continue;
}
if (!attr->value_ctr.values[0].blob) {
continue;
}
blob = attr->value_ctr.values[0].blob;
switch (attr->attid) {
case DRSUAPI_ATTRIBUTE_unicodePwd:
if (blob->length != 16) {
break;
}
memcpy(&nt_passwd, blob->data, 16);
got_pwd = true;
/* pick the kvno from the meta_data version,
* thanks, metze, for explaining this */
if (!cur->meta_data_ctr) {
break;
}
if (cur->meta_data_ctr->count !=
cur->object.attribute_ctr.num_attributes) {
break;
}
kvno = cur->meta_data_ctr->meta_data[i].version;
break;
case DRSUAPI_ATTRIBUTE_ntPwdHistory:
pwd_history_len = blob->length / 16;
pwd_history = blob->data;
break;
case DRSUAPI_ATTRIBUTE_msDS_KeyVersionNumber:
kvno = IVAL(blob->data, 0);
break;
case DRSUAPI_ATTRIBUTE_userPrincipalName:
pull_string_talloc(mem_ctx, NULL, 0, &upn,
blob->data, blob->length,
STR_UNICODE);
break;
case DRSUAPI_ATTRIBUTE_sAMAccountName:
pull_string_talloc(mem_ctx, NULL, 0, &name,
blob->data, blob->length,
STR_UNICODE);
break;
case DRSUAPI_ATTRIBUTE_sAMAccountType:
sam_type = IVAL(blob->data, 0);
break;
case DRSUAPI_ATTRIBUTE_userAccountControl:
uacc = IVAL(blob->data, 0);
break;
default:
break;
}
}
if (!got_pwd || !name) {
return NT_STATUS_OK;
}
DEBUG(1,("#%02d: %s:%d, ", ctx->count, name, kvno));
DEBUGADD(1,("sAMAccountType: 0x%08x, userAccountControl: 0x%08x ",
sam_type, uacc));
if (upn) {
DEBUGADD(1,("upn: %s", upn));
}
DEBUGADD(1,("\n"));
entry.kvno = kvno;
entry.name = talloc_strdup(mem_ctx, name);
entry.principal = talloc_asprintf(mem_ctx, "%s@%s",
name, ctx->dns_domain_name);
entry.password = data_blob_talloc(mem_ctx, nt_passwd, 16);
NT_STATUS_HAVE_NO_MEMORY(entry.name);
NT_STATUS_HAVE_NO_MEMORY(entry.principal);
NT_STATUS_HAVE_NO_MEMORY(entry.password.data);
ADD_TO_ARRAY(mem_ctx, struct libnet_keytab_entry, entry,
&ctx->entries, &ctx->count);
if ((kvno < 0) && (kvno < pwd_history_len)) {
return status;
}
/* add password history */
/* skip first entry */
if (got_pwd) {
kvno--;
i = 1;
} else {
i = 0;
}
for (; i<pwd_history_len; i++) {
entry.kvno = kvno--;
entry.name = talloc_strdup(mem_ctx, name);
entry.principal = talloc_asprintf(mem_ctx, "%s@%s",
name, ctx->dns_domain_name);
entry.password = data_blob_talloc(mem_ctx, &pwd_history[i*16], 16);
NT_STATUS_HAVE_NO_MEMORY(entry.name);
NT_STATUS_HAVE_NO_MEMORY(entry.principal);
NT_STATUS_HAVE_NO_MEMORY(entry.password.data);
ADD_TO_ARRAY(mem_ctx, struct libnet_keytab_entry, entry,
&ctx->entries, &ctx->count);
}
return status;
}
